Решил сделать анонс своего нового проекта под рабочим названием firebird. Цель проекта - дать пользователю максимально полную картину происходящего в небе. Данные будут формироваться на основе HACARS, VACARS, ADS-B сообщений, по этим сообщениям будет строится общая картина.
Проект на стадии разработки, пишу я его только по выходным, поэтому закончу не скоро, но уже кое что работает. Суть - декодированные сообщения будут приниматься через сеть и иметь определенный формат, сторонний разработчик может писать любые декодеры, которые работают с разнообразным железом, главное декодер должен подымать сервер на локальной/удаленной машине и передавать пакеты в заданном формате. В этом программном комплексе используется OpenStreetMap что дает возможность отображать четыре разные типы карт(подробней см http://www.openstreetmap.org/), вот 2 из них
В качестве языка выбран JAVA по двум причинам - моя работа напрямую связана с ним и он переносим на другие ОС. Мультиплатформенность - это было основной целью т.к. подобного рода софт работает в основном под ОС Windows, firebird будет бесплатным и скорее всего с открытым исходным кодом(когда я приведу код в более менее презентабельный вид) - это основное отличие от подобного софта. Из минусов отмечу вот, что - нужны разработчики, которые будут писать "интерфейсы" под разные платформы для декодеров, я постараюсь написать несколько таких интерфейсов под самые распространенные Windows декодеры. Надеюсь, что появятся энтузиасты, которые напишут интерфейсы под другие ОС. FireBird сможет работать как с удаленной, так и с локальной базой данных - это даст возможность полноценно работать не имея соединения с сетью Internet. Надеюсь усилия мои будут не напрасны и данным продуктом будут пользоваться и писать под него декодеры или усовершенствовать его.


0 коммент.:
Отправить комментарий